All rights reserved | 3 Highlights of Q2FY26 8.4% Revenue Growth Year-on-Year 15.5% Operating EBITDA Margin 13.2% 12 Months Order backlog Year-on-Year Growth Q2FY26 revenue at ₹ 940.4 Crore Q2FY26 Op. EBITDA at ₹ 145.5 Crore 12 Months Order backlog at ₹ 2,484.3 Crore Revenue grew by 2.3% YoY (CC*) Op. EBITDA grew by 1.7% YoY 12 months order backlog grew by 6.8% YoY (USD terms) Secured 25+ new AI deals for Q2FY26 across AI for Technology, Business and Data Investor Presentation Q2FY26 Company Confidential © Mastek 2025.
